Structural Project Engineer at Day & Zimmermann in Virginia Beach, VA

The Work You'll Be Doing:
Perform and direct research, analysis, design, and evaluation of structural components and systems (foundations, slabs, beams, columns, walls, etc.) to meet project requirements, applying knowledge of structural engineering principles. Perform complex engineering calculations; select and design site and building structural systems. Direct preparation of construction drawings and specifications for projects in coordination with calculations performed. Manage structural department scope for project. Check work delegated to other engineers and designers on project to ensure scope is documented successfully. Serve as main point of contact to clients for structural department project responsibilities (meetings, conference calls, comment review/responses, etc.). Lead construction phase contract administration activities for structural department on projects such as Submittals, RFIs, construction support, etc. What You Need to Bring to the Table:

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
